I am entering this card into the new challenge at Cheery Lynn Designs
red ~ white ~ blue
I used a Cheery Lynn die called Bow and Bell (DL163).....
though, the die comes with it's own bow die....
I chose to use a red, white, and blue ribbon I had...
I used TH ink on my embossing folder, then ran it thru, and a piece of scrap paper
for the background....
a SU star punch with my God Bless America stamp to finish it off!!
